I used Riken Ohms and tantalums. The Rikens I got from THlAudio in
Taiwan. I replaced some grainy sounding metal oxides with them and found them smooth and detailed. The 1% tolerance is unheard of in Carbon resistors too. The tantalums I used in the power supply of my amp and as a shunt resistor for a volume control. Again, nice smooth sound with lots of detail. Expensive but recommended.
